Small businesses in Kingswood are being encouraged to sharpen their local search presence by focusing on Google My Business (GMB) and proven local SEO tactics. For enterprises across Gloucestershire, an optimised GMB profile can improve how often a business appears in local searches and can increase customer engagement both online and in person.

Core local SEO techniques start with consistency: ensure your business name, address and phone number (NAP) match across your GMB listing, website and directory citations. Use clear category selections, include relevant local keywords in business descriptions and on landing pages, and make sure your website is mobile-friendly and fast to support search performance.

On the GMB profile itself, regular updates help keep listings fresh and useful. Add accurate hours, high-quality photos, service details and timely posts; manage the Q&A section and respond to customer reviews to build trust. These routine actions make a profile more informative for potential customers and signal activity to local search algorithms.

Monitoring and local outreach complete the strategy: review GMB insights to see how customers find and interact with your listing, maintain consistent citations in local directories, and seek partnerships or local links that reinforce relevance within Kingswood. Together, these approaches aim to raise visibility, attract more local enquiries, and strengthen community presence without relying on broad, generic SEO alone.
